Description

The INTASAVE Partnership and CARIBSAVE are seeking an experienced and self-motivated individual for the position of Project Development and Fundraising Officer (PD & FO), initially for a one year term (open to renewal for the right candidate).  The PD & FO will work directly with the Director of Philanthropy and International Development, identifying and delivering on opportunities to secure significant resources and funding from a variety of major national, regional and international donors and organisations. The other duties of the position are:

  • Undertaking preliminary research for funding proposals; which may be specific to a climate related activity or for a particular donor;
  • Undertaking research, to include collecting, collating and analysing information and data, relevant to INTASAVE’s and CARIBSAVE’s current and potential work;
  • Developing and writing complex climate related proposals, for example to research councils, statutory donors and global funding institutions;
  • Completing Suitability Statements and other promotional pieces for third-party funding submissions;
  • Promoting INTASAVE and its work in Africa;
  • Identifying and researching suitable donors;
  • Assisting with communications and marketing tasks, associated with fundraising, e.g. website, copy.

Essential selection criteria is as follows:

  • Master’s degree or equivalent experience in climate change, or a similar subject with strong focus on climate change;
  • Knowledge and experience of sustainable development issues and/or climate compatible development;
  • Experience of writing complex documents for consumption by both technical and non-technical users;
  • Experience of adjusting written and verbal communication for specific target audiences;
  • Ability to review, analyse and synthesise long and detailed documents and reports;
  • Excellent written and communication skills;
  • Strong computer skills, particularly digital presentations, Word documents and Excel calculations;
  • Ability to work under pressure and meet regular tight deadlines;
  • A flexible, methodical and conscientious approach to work;
  • Ability to work both independently and as a team;
  • Self motivated and passionate about the subject of climate change.

The INTASAVE Partnership & CARIBSAVE are Not-For-Profit (NFP) international organisations with regional headquarters in the Caribbean, Africa and UK/Europe, working across South-South regions and China. The INTASAVE Partnership (INTASAVE) works around the world with governments, regional organisations, communities, the private sector, universities, international development agencies and development banks.
